I am going to start my pre-trip inspection by checking my HOSES. Making sure they are properly mounted and secure. There are no abrasions, bulges, or cuts. And they are Not Leaking. Next, I am going to check my WIRES making sure they are properly mounted and secure Not ripped, torn, or frayed. There are No exposed wires and No signs of corrosion. Next, I am going to check the BELT DRIVEN ALTERNATOR. Making sure it is properly mounted and secure. Not cracked, bent, or broken, And there are No signs of corrosion. Next, I am going to check the BELT DRIVEN WATER PUMP Making sure it is properly mounted and secure. Not cracked, bent, or broken, and Not leaking. Next, I am going to check the SERPENTINE BELTS. Making sure they are properly mounted and secure. They are not ripped, torn, or frayed, and there is No more than three-fourths of an inch play when pulled. I’m going to check my HOSES&WHIRES as I did on the passenger side. Next I am going to check the COOLANT RESERVOIR. Making sure it is properly mounted and secure. Not cracked, bent, or broken. And it is Not leaking. IF I want to check the level I would Check it here and If I want to fill it I will fill it here I would Never fill it when the truck is running or the engine is hot. Next, I am going to check the OIL FILL PORT and OIL DIP STICK. Making sure they are properly mounted and secure. Not cracked, bent, or broken, and they are not leaking. If I need to check the level, I would check it here if I need to fill it I would fill it here. Next I am going to check the GEAR DRIVEN AIR COMPRESSOR & GEAR DRIVEN POWER STEERING PUMP. Making sure they are properly mounted and secure. Not cracked, bent, or broken. They are not leaking. Next I am going to check the POWER STEERING RESERVOIR. Making sure it is properly mounted and secure. Not cracked, bent, or broken. And it is not leaking. If I need to check the level, I would check it here. If I need to fill it, I would fill it here. Next I am going to check the STEERING SHAFT. Making sure it is properly mounted and secure. And there are no more than 10 inches in either direction. Next I am going to check the POWER STEERING GEAR BOX. Make sure it is properly mounted and secure with nuts and bolts to the frame of the truck. Not cracked, bent, or broken and Not leaking. Next, I am going to check the steering components: The PITMAN ARM, DRAG LINK, STEERING ARM, STEERING KNUCKLE AND TIE ROD. Making sure they are properly mounted and secured with castle nuts and cotter pins. Not cracked, bent, or broken, and properly greased. Next, I am going to check the suspension components. Starting with the LEAF SPRING HANGERS, both front, and back. Making sure they are properly mounted and secure. Not cracked, bent, or broken, and not missing. Next, I am going to check the LEAF SPRINGS. Making sure they are properly mounted and secure at the front and rear. Not cracked bent, or broken, and non-missing. Next, I am going to check the U-BOLTS. Making sure they are properly mounted and secure. Not cracked, bent, or broken, and no signs of slippage. Next, I am going to check the SHOCK ABSORBER. Making sure it is properly mounted and secured at the top and bottom. Not cracked, bent, or broken, and not leaking. Next, I am going to check the brake components. Starting with the BRAKE HOSE making sure it is properly mounted and secure. There are no abrasions, bulges, or cuts, and it is not leaking. Next, I’m going to check the BRAKE CHAMBER. Making sure it is properly mounted and secure. Not cracked, bent, or broken, and it is not leaking. Next I am going to check the PUSH ROD AND SLACK ADJUSTER. Making sure they are properly mounted and secured with pins and cotter pins. Not cracked, bent, or broken. There can be no more than one inch of play with the brakes disengaged. Next I am going to check the BRAKE DRUM. Making sure it is properly mounted and secure. Not cracked, bent, or broken. Smooth on the inside and free from debris. Next I am going to check the BRAKE SHOES. Making sure they are properly mounted and secure. Not cracked, bent, or broken. There can be no less than one-quarter of an inch of material left. Next I am going to check the INNER HUB SEAL. Making sure they are properly mounted and secure. Not cracked, bent, or broken, and it is not leaking. Next I am going to check the OUTER HUB SEAL. Making sure they are properly mounted and secure. Not cracked, bent, or broken, and it is not leaking. IF I need to check the level, I would check it here by inserting my finger into the hoe, up to the first knuckle. If I need to fill it, I would fill it here. Next I am going to check the BUDD RIM. Making sure it is properly mounted and secure. Not cracked, bent, or broken. And, there are no illegal welds. Next, I am going to check the LUG NUTS. Making sure they are properly mounted and secure. Not cracked, bent, or broken. None are missing. I’m going to look for signs of rust trails or shinny threads which could be an indication of a loss lug nut. Next, I am going to check my VALVE STEM AND CAP, making sure it is properly mounted and secure. Not cracked, bent, or broken. And, not leaking. The cap should be in place to prevent debris from getting in. If I wanted to check my pressure, I would check it here with an air gauge. IF I need to fill it, I would fill it here with an air chuck. I can find the manufacturer suggested hot and cold PSI for this tire on the side wall. Next, I am going to check the TIRE. Making sure it is properly mounted and secure. There are no abrasions, bulges, or cuts, and it is not leaking. I am looking for even and smooth tread wear across the foot of the tire. Because it is a steer tire it has to be a virgin tire and can have no less than 4/32 of an inch of tread depth. Next, I am going to check the MIRRORS. Making sure they are properly mounted and secure. Not cracked, bent, or broken. And, not missing. Next, I am going to check the DOOR. Making sure it opens and closes properly. I am going to check for door sag. If there is door sag it could be an indication of a broken or missing door hinge. Next, I’m going to check the DOOR HINGES. Making sure they are properly mounted and secure. Not cracked, bent, or broken, and non missing. Next, I’m going to check the INNER AND OUTER DOOR SEAL. Making sure they are properly mounted and secure. Not ripped, torn, or frayed, and not leaking. Next, I’m going to check the DRIVER SIDE STAIRS. Making sure they are properly mounted and secure. Not cracked, bent, or broken, and can support my weights as the driver. Next, I’m going to check the FUEL TANK. Making sure it is properly mounted and secure. Not cracked, bent, or broken. And. Not leaking.
